The One Man Who Could Crack This Wide Open
It took years. Rebuilding trust with Victor Newman (Eric Braeden) is not something that happens overnight, and Michael Baldwin (Christian LeBlanc) knows that better than anyone. He clawed his way back into that inner circle. He earned it. And now — with a ticking clock, a captive hostage, and his closest friends in freefall — he may be about to throw every bit of it away.
The situation is messy. Jack Abbott (Peter Bergman) is being held against his will on a yacht at a marina — Victor’s leverage in a brutal ultimatum aimed at Billy Abbott (Jason Thompson). Hand over Chancellor, or Jack pays the price. Twenty-four hours. That’s the deal.
But here’s the problem Victor may not have fully calculated: Michael is in the room. And Michael is smart enough to figure things out.

Lauren Fenmore Baldwin Turns Up the Heat
This is where things get truly uncomfortable for Michael Baldwin. His wife, Lauren Fenmore Baldwin (Tracey E. Bregman), finds out about Jack’s abduction — and she is not going to let her husband hide behind professional loyalty on this one.
Lauren knows exactly what she would want Michael to do if the situation were reversed. She would want him to move heaven and earth. No hesitation. No calculating the political fallout. She would want him to act like the man she married. And she is going to tell him exactly that.
The question is whether Michael can figure out the marina location and leak it to the Abbotts without Victor connecting the dots back to him. Because if Victor finds out? That restored trust evaporates. Permanently. There are no more second chances after something like this.
Phyllis Is Stalling and the Clock Is Running
There is one more complication buried inside all of this. Phyllis Summers (Michelle Stafford) is technically the one sitting on Chancellor. Victor gave Billy the ultimatum, but Phyllis controls the actual transfer — and she is dragging her feet. Every hour she stalls is another hour Jack stays on that yacht.
Reading between the lines, this is not an accident. Phyllis has her own agenda, and slowing down Victor’s deadline serves her purposes just fine. Don’t be surprised if her stalling is the thing that finally forces Michael’s hand. If the deal cannot close on time and Victor escalates his threat, Michael may have no choice but to act.
